To provide a process for producing, at a high content ratio, 1,1-dichloro-2,2,3,3,3-pentafluoropropane (HCFC-225ca) which is useful as e.g. a starting material to obtain 1,1-dichloro-2,3,3,3-tetrafluoropropene (CFO1214ya).
The process for producing HCFC-225ca of the present invention comprises subjecting a raw material composed of dichloropentafluoropropane (HCFC-225) including 2,2-dichloro-1,1,1,3,3-pentafluoropropane (HCFC225aa) to an isomerization reaction at a temperature of at most 290° C. in a gas phase in the presence of a metal oxide catalyst thereby to isomerize HCFC-225aa to HCFC-225ca.
The relationship between 19F chemical shifts in halogenated propanes and their structures are elucidated using MNDO calculations to determine the population of rotamers. The pairs of atoms gauche to a fluorine atom and van der Waals interaction between the two terminal substituents are responsible for the 19F chemical shifts. The differences among chemical shifts in diastereomers are also discussed

Process for preparing 1,1,1,2,2-Pentafluoro-3, 3-Dichloropropane and 1,1,2,2,3-Pentafluoro-1,3-Dichloropropane

1,1,1,2,2-Pentafluoro-3,3-dichloropropane and 1,1,2,2,3-pentafluoro-1,3-dichloropropane are prepared by reacting tetrafluoroethylene a mixture of chloroform and difluorochloromethane in the presence of a catalyst selected from the group consisting of anhydrous titanium tetrachloride and a titanium chlorofluoride of the formula: TiClxFy in which x and y are independently a number of larger than 0 and smaller than 4 provided that a sum of x and y is 4, by which by-production of 2,2-dichloro-1,1,1,3,3-pentafluoropropane is suppressed.
